Output 83e7a09f45c039a250aea6b91379274aea26bb996957366741bf74f2498649ba:69

value
50196392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cff3f98be7e3281c06e9fd7970ea758ada33606 OP_EQUAL
address
3D5wVJUkphPUUv4RXG3GTAQ19UrjQSiTjq
transaction
83e7a09f45c039a250aea6b91379274aea26bb996957366741bf74f2498649ba